GIP Paving named preferred proponent in Ontario’s Highway 3 widening project

April 11, 2023  By Rock to Road Staff


April 11, 2023, TORONTO – Infrastructure Ontario and the Ministry of Transportation have selected GIP Paving as the preferred proponent in the Highway 3 widening project, taking place between Essex and Leamington.

The procurement process was overseen by a third-party fairness advisor to ensure openness, with financial close expected to occur in Spring 2023.

GIP Paving would be responsible for designing, building, and financing the project, which aims to widen Highway 3 from two lanes to four lanes between Essex Road 23’s Arner Townline and Union Avenue (Essex Road 34) outside of Leamington.

The GIP Paving team for this project is comprised of Dillon Consulting and WSP overseeing the design process, National Bank Financial in the role of financial advisor, and GIP Paving serving as the developer and the project’s construction team.
